She ran it in the following fashion:

All of the baskets were placed out and had a little ticket bucket in front of them.... she sold tickets $1=1 $5=6 $20=30 and then people would put their name/number on the ticket and place it in the bucket/basket of the items they wanted. We collected tickets for 3 days (Friday-Sunday), then on Sunday at like 10pm when the band that was playing at the venue took a break she got up and pulled the names out in front of everyone.... people who were there claimed their stuff, those who were got a call and have two weeks to make arrangements or they will go to a backup name.
Throughout the nights she also had 50/50 raffles for just straigh cash.

The competition is laid out in the following way:
Half the girls compete in "Lifestyle health and fitness competition --- lets just call it Swimsuit and On-Stage question on Wednesday, then Talent and evening gown on Thursday
The other half of the girls do talent and evening gown on Wednesday, and then swimsuit and on-stage question on Thursday
.... then top 10 are selected first thing on Saturday and all compete again, in swimsuit , talent, and evening gown.... then they pick a top 5, then the top 5 answer a question on stage (usually a loaded political/touchy issue) and that is how they pick the winner.
